Simple Word Counter: Quickly Count Words and Characters
Simple Word Counter is a practical Chrome extension designed to streamline the task of counting words and characters in your selected text. Just by highlighting the text, a popup will immediately show the total word and character count.
Key Features:
• Instant Word and Character Count: Simply highlight any text and a tooltip will promptly display the total count of words and characters.
• Customizable Tooltip: Manage the tooltip's visibility effortlessly with a straightforward on/off toggle.

Just like the last such plugin I tried, this counts em-dashes as word-connectors. This is not how the em-dash works. A hyphen connects words: jack-in-the-box counts as a single word. An em-dash *separates* phrases. It's a way of stopping one thought to bring in another one, kinda like parentheses, or for conveying a kind of frantic, jumbled sequence of events. The following would be twelve words each: He wanted to see her again—if only for one bitter moment. For her sake—though it pained him greatly—he would do it. Panting, he turned—glanced around frantically—spotted her—rushed to her side. Your program would count these as 11, 10, and 9, respectively. Individually, that's not a huge amount, but when you start dealing with longer content, it adds up to a lot. I checked with a piece with a known count of 21,586; this plugin claimed 21,356, a discrepancy of 230, probably close to the number of em-dashes in the tale. Please fix this. I would like to be notified if you do. P.S. You might also look into the en-dash and determine its function; it doesn't work like a hyphen, but is a little more complicated. The em-dash *never* connects words, but the en-dash might (though it's also much rarer). Excellent Plugin, what i love most about it is its simplicity. No fancy stuff, just character counting. As an SEO specialist, i use this to count characters for Meta Titles and Meta descriptions. However I gave it four stars because the plugin only counts characters without spacing. Google's counts the Meta Titles and Meta descriptions counts characters with spacing. My message to the developer is please give us the option to count the characters with spacing and/or without spacing. A toggle feature in the options to select what would be displayed would be so helpful. Thank you
